Humber Valley Village, Toronto is a west Toronto neighbourhood notable for its university grads, executives and science professionals. It has a higher than average population of Italian and Ukrainian speakers. Residents tend to be older with a significant number of youth aged 15 to 19, adults aged 50 to 64 and seniors aged 65 to 74 and 65 to 74.
